The 20-year-old apparently developed fear of swing's height


Gujranwala: A 20-year-old girl died after falling from a swing at Gulshan Iqbal Park in Gujranwala, rescuers and police said.
Along with her family Aqsa came to the park and rided a swing. She went unconsious after falling from height as she apparently developed fear of swing's height.
Rescuers were called to the spot. The girl was pronounced dead at the scene after several attempts of getting her breath restored. Her body was shifted to the DHQ Hospital.
Punjab Chief Minister Sardar Usman Buzdar took notice of the incident and sought report from Gujranwala Commissioner about the incident.
He ordered the commissioner to first identify those responsible for mishap.
Case against swing operator
Later, Dhallay police registered a case against swing operator and others on the complaint of Aqsa's father who complianed that his daughter died due to negliegnce of swing operator who failed to control swing in time.
Inquiry committee constituted
The Gujranwala Deputy Commissioner constituted an inquity committed led by the Assistant Commissioner City to fix the responsibility. The park was also closed for public till the outcome of the inquiry.
